About the Ukraine Section

European Relations’ Ukraine Section provides a platform for exploring the multifaceted relationship between Ukraine and Europe. Contributions address a wide range of themes, from the impact of European influences on Ukrainian domestic developments – such as in the economy, public administration, or particular policy areas – to questions of security and Russia’s war against Ukraine, Ukrainian foreign policy and Ukraine’s relations with the EU and European Countries, as well as European resonance of Ukrainian affairs. 

The aim of the Ukraine Section is to give greater visibility to Ukrainian affairs and perspectives across Europe. While Russia’s war against Ukraine inevitably looms large, the section also seeks to highlight other developments that shape the country’s trajectory, including reforms, societal debates, and long-term challenges. By broadening the conversation beyond the war alone, the Ukraine Section raises awareness of Ukraine’s political, social, and cultural dynamics and fosters a deeper understanding of how they matter for Europe as a whole.
